Bill would deport undocumented immigrants convicted of sex offenses, domestic violence, stalking, child abuse or violating a protection order.
It comes as immigration is among the most important issues on the minds of voters ahead of November 's election.
Studies have generally found no link between immigration and violent crime.
Opponents of the bill said it was demonizing immigrants.
